At long last

When she whispers my name, my heart leaps but, I cannot go to her. I must not. It’d be wrong. But relentlessly she beckons me and I give into temptation. I’m only a man.

As my head hits the pillow, I sigh, “Oh Sleep, at long last I’m yours.
